Anyone know anything about these? I was particularly interested, because (1/N) times the matrix of all ones acts like a kind of "zero" in that it wipes out all information about any circulant markov matrix that it multiplies. If Z = matrix([1,1,...,1],[1,1,...,1],...,[1,1,...,1]), and if M is any circulant markov matrix (sum of rows & cols = 1), then Z.M = M.Z = Z Note that |Z.M|=|Z||M|=|M||Z|=|M.Z|=|Z|=0, so this makes sense.
